I believe John L. Southard was the brother of my great-grandfather, Gray Southard. 4 Southard brothers were drafted in 1862 to serve in Company D of the 45th NC Regiment, and one (Macklin) was killed at Spotsylvania. Company D was sent to Danville, Virginia, to serve as prison guards at a POW camp (actually a prison in tobacco warehouses) in Danville. It was here that my great-grandfather's brother died of disease (while serving as a guard). My grandfather, John Southard, was, I believe, named after his uncle.
